flyin ryan - Im in the middle of installing a GT40 intake, Will I use the mustang EGR still if im using the explorer TB?
The explorer egr is 65mm where as the stocker from your mustang is 55 or 52mm I forget. I'd go with the matching 65mm if your using the explorer tb but either way your shit will work it'll just be alittle bottleknecked with the smaller non matching spacer if you choose to use the stock mustang one over the exploerer for whatever reason.
